The popular Romanian Hacker Guccifer will be extradited to US soon

The Romania’s High Court of Cassation and Justice ruled that the popular Romanian hacker Guccifer will be extradited to the United States.

Marcel Lazar Lehel it the real name of the name of the notorious hacker Guccifer who breached the online accounts of several public figures between December 2012 and January 2014.

The popular hacker revealed he violated the accounts of his victims by guessing the answers to security questions.

News of the day is that the 42-year-old Romanian national hacker will be extradited to the United States, the decision was taken by a Romania’s High Court of Cassation and Justice. The Romanian supreme court approved the request of US authorities on Friday, the local authorities will hand over Guccifer to the United States for a period of 18 months.

Authorities believe Guccifer hacked into the email accounts of several individuals in the United States, including former Secretary of State Colin Powell, members of the Bush family, venture capitalist John Doerr, military officials, actors, and journalists.

Guccifer also hacked, at least, the accounts of two Romanian officials.

The man was arrested in January 2014 by the Romanian police in a joint operation with the US authorities, in June of the same year he was sentenced to seven years in prison for hacking the accounts of Romanian politician Corina Cretu and George Maior, the head of the Romanian Intelligence Service (SRI).

A US federal grand jury also indicted Guccifer on charges of wire fraud, identity theft, unauthorized access to a protected computer, and cyberstalking.
